4-Day Itinerary for Jasalmar

Monday, December 25: Exploring Jasalmar

Start your trip by immersing yourself in the rich cultural heritage of Jasalmar. In the morning, visit the magnificent Jasalmar Fort, also known as the "Golden Fort," which offers breathtaking views of the city. Explore the intricately carved palaces and enjoy a peaceful walk through the narrow lanes of the fort. In the afternoon, head to Patwon Ki Haveli, a collection of five intricately designed havelis showcasing the architectural brilliance of the region. Wrap up your day by witnessing the mesmerizing sunset at the Sam Sand Dunes, where you can enjoy camel rides and traditional Rajasthani folk music and dance.

  • Jasalmar Fort: Entrance fee - INR 50, Time spent - 3-4 hours
  • Patwon Ki Haveli: Entrance fee - INR 100, Time spent - 1-2 hours
  • Sam Sand Dunes: Camel ride - INR 300, Time spent - Evening

Tuesday, December 26: Discovering Jasalmar's Heritage

Embark on a journey to explore the rich heritage of Jasalmar. Start your morning by visiting the stunning Bada Bagh, a complex of royal cenotaphs showcasing Rajasthani architectural style. In the afternoon, explore the Jasalmar Heritage Museum, which houses an impressive collection of artifacts, textiles, and artworks depicting the cultural history of the region. In the evening, visit the Gadisar Lake, a serene oasis surrounded by temples and cenotaphs, where you can enjoy a peaceful boat ride and witness the beautiful sunset.

  • Bada Bagh: Entrance fee - INR 100,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Jasalmar Heritage Museum: Entrance fee - INR 50, Time spent - 1-2 hours
  • Gadisar Lake: Boat ride - INR 200, Time spent - Evening
Wednesday, December 27: Desert Safari and Cultural Experience

Embark on an exciting desert safari adventure to explore the vibrant culture of Jasalmar. Start your day by visiting the Kuldhara Village, an abandoned village known for its mysterious history. In the afternoon, head to the Desert National Park, where you can witness the unique flora and fauna of the Thar Desert. Experience an exhilarating camel safari and enjoy the traditional Rajasthani cuisine at a desert camp. In the evening, indulge in a cultural extravaganza with a folk dance and music performance under the starry desert sky.

  • Kuldhara Village: Entrance fee - INR 50,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Desert National Park: Entrance fee - INR 100, Time spent - 1-2 hours
  • Camel Safari and Desert Camp: Cost - INR 1500, Time spent - Evening
Thursday, December 28: Jain Temples and Handicrafts

Spend your last day exploring the spiritual and artistic side of Jasalmar. Begin your morning with a visit to the Jain Temples, known for their intricate marble carvings and stunning architecture. In the afternoon, explore the bustling local markets, such as Manak Chowk and Sadar Bazaar, where you can shop for traditional handicrafts, textiles, and jewelry. End your trip by witnessing the art of pottery-making at Khuri Village and trying your hand at creating your unique pottery masterpiece.

  • Jain Temples: Entrance fee - INR 50,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Local Markets: Shopping budget - INR 1000,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Khuri Village Pottery: Workshop cost - INR 500, Time spent - Evening

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

While exploring Jasalmar, don't miss the chance to visit Kuldhara Abandoned Village, which carries an intriguing tale of its mysterious abandonment. Another hidden gem is the Salim Singh Ki Haveli, an architectural marvel featuring exquisite balconies and ornate carvings. Locals love to unwind at the Amar Sagar Lake, a serene spot offering stunning views and a peaceful atmosphere. Finally, indulge in the local cuisine of Jasalmar which includes delicacies like Ker Sangri, Dal Bati Churma, and Ghotua Laddu.
